Summary

The biosynthesis of the alkaloids ofAmmothamnus lehmannii Bge. have been studied by supplying the plants with [1,5-14C2] cadaverine. It has been shown that cadaverine is a precursor of sophocarpidine, sophocarpine, and pachycarpine. Possible routes of interconversions have been studied by supplying the plants with the tritium-labelled alkaloids [3H] sophocarpine, [3H] matrine, and [3H] pachycarpine.
